Simple Egg Fried Rice Without Sauce

This easy egg fried rice recipe uses basic ingredients and no traditional sauces. Instead, it relies on natural flavors from aromatics, a pinch of salt, and a splash of vinegar and sesame oil for a tasty, quick meal.

Easy 15 min 350 cal
Steps

1. Heat oil in a non-stick pan over medium heat. 2. Add minced garlic and chopped onion; sauté until fragrant and translucent. 3. Crack the egg into the pan and scramble quickly until just set. 4. Add the cooked rice, breaking up any clumps, and stir-fry to combine everything. 5. Sprinkle salt and black pepper to taste. 6. Drizzle the vinegar and sesame oil over the rice and mix well to distribute flavors. 7. Cook for another 2-3 minutes until the rice is heated through and slightly crispy at the bottom. 8. Garnish with chopped green onion if using and serve hot.

Ingredients

1 cup cooked rice (preferably day-old) 1 large egg 1 small clove garlic, minced 1/4 small onion, finely chopped 1 tbsp vegetable oil 1/2 tsp white or apple cider vinegar 1/4 tsp toasted sesame oil (optional) Salt to taste Freshly ground black pepper to taste 1 green onion, chopped (optional)
